RealityMAX is the go-to platform for 3D design collaboration, product visualization, and augmented shopper engagement. Combine multiple models and objects in almost any 3D/2D format (we support .glb, .gltf, .fbx, .3dm, .obj, .dae, .stl, .3ds, .3mf, .png, .jpeg/jpg, .heic/.heif, .webp, and more – also zipped folders). Visualize and manipulate 3D objects. Create Smart Materials that adapt automatically as you transform the object. Invite teammates and clients to work with you in the same virtual environment. Share your creations as a Web 3D or AR experience with call-to-action buttons (also through password-protected links and QR Codes). Insert interactive 3D in your website or app easily with a copy-and-paste embed code. Track visits to your scenes.

  1. Best online 3D tool I've tried so far

    Great for editing models and putting together complex scenes directly in the browser. I have used it for several interior design projects and it worked smoothly all the time. Also cool that you can share your stuff in augmented reality with a couple of clicks. That made my clients go crazy >D

    🏁 Competitors: Omniverse
    👍 Pros:    Accepts any type of 3d file i've tried|Intuitive to use|Fast rendering|You can make ar quickly|3d embed available
    👎 Cons:    Not a fan of the dark mode|Navigation of the model elements can be improved

  • How much should my boss be paying me for design work, percentage wise?
    When I worked as a Graphic Designer at an online print-shop similar to moo or psprint.com etc, I was being paid $21/hr (plus benefits, and so on), obviously not using my own hardware. This was back in 2006. I was mostly doing correction work for customer submitted files, and then I would send these to pre-press or reject the file, with a small smattering of walk-in and appointment based design.
